Discover Tena: Where Lush Rainforests Embrace Majestic Rivers and Hidden Volcanoes

Nestled in the heart of Ecuador's Amazon rainforest, Tena is a vibrant gateway to adventure and natural beauty. Known as the Gateway to the Amazon, this charming town boasts stunning landscapes, including lush jungles, winding rivers, and breathtaking waterfalls. Experience thrilling activities like white-water rafting, zip-lining through the treetops, or exploring indigenous cultures in nearby villages. Tena's warm climate and rich biodiversity make it a paradise for nature lovers and thrill-seekers alike. Whether you're seeking relaxation or adventure, Tena offers an unforgettable immersion into Ecuador's wild and enchanting allure.

Things to do in Tena

Tena is a vibrant haven where lush rainforests meet winding rivers, offering a playground for outdoor enthusiasts. Dive into thrilling rafting adventures, glide through serene canoeing journeys, or relax while innertubing. With breathtaking landscapes and abundant wildlife, it's an unforgettable escape for nature lovers and thrill-seekers alike.

  • Jumandy CavernsOpens in a new window – Venture into the depths of Jumandy Caverns, a stunning cave system that showcases the natural wonders of the Ecuadorian jungle. As you explore its impressive rock formations and underground rivers, you'll feel the thrill of adventure in every step.
  • Jondachi RiverOpens in a new window – Grab your kayak or simply relax by the shores of the Jondachi River. This beautiful river winds through lush rainforest, offering opportunities for exhilarating water sports or peaceful moments surrounded by nature. Don't miss the chance to take a refreshing dip!
  • Latas WaterfallOpens in a new window – Hike through the verdant trails leading to Latas Waterfall, where you can marvel at the cascading waters plunging into a serene pool. It's an ideal spot for photos and a perfect place to soak up the tranquility of the surrounding rainforest.
  • Quechua Indigenous CommunityOpens in a new window – Engage with the Quechua Indigenous Community to learn about their rich traditions and way of life. Participate in local crafts, taste authentic cuisine, and gain insight into their connection with the land and nature.
  • Sanctuary of the Virgin of QuincheOpens in a new window – Visit the Sanctuary of the Virgin of Quinche, a revered shrine nestled in the picturesque landscape. Observe the intricate architecture and take a moment for reflection as you appreciate the spiritual significance of this site.

Best time to go to Tena

Tena experiences its lowest average temperature in July, at 62.6°F (17.0°C), while November is the hottest month, with an average temperature of 65.8°F (18.8°C). April is usually the wettest month. February, April, and August are the peak travel months in Tena, attracting a higher number of tourists. During this peak period, the weather is mostly cloudy, accompanied by moderate to frequent rainfall. On the other hand, June, October, and November tend to be quieter times to visit, marked by moderate to frequent rainfall and mostly cloudy conditions.
